Carrols Restaurant Group names new CFO

Anthony Hull

SYRACUSE, N.Y. — Carrols Restaurant Group, Inc. (NASDAQ: TAST) on Monday announced that it has appointed Anthony (Tony) E. Hull as the firm’s VP, CFO, and treasurer, effective Jan. 2, 2020.

Syracuse–based Carrols is the largest Burger King franchisee in the U.S.

“Tony is a fantastic addition to the Carrols executive team and we look forward to benefiting from his well-established credentials and experience,” Daniel Accordino, chairman and CEO of Carrols, said Monday. “Throughout his extensive career, he has demonstrated effective leadership across a number of different industries while making impressive contributions along the way.”

Accordino also thanked Tim LaLonde for serving as interim CFO since September when he temporarily rejoined Carrols after the death of the previous CFO Paul Flanders.

“Tim will continue to serve as our interim CFO until Jan. 2, 2020 when Tony will start as CFO and will serve in a transitionary role for a period of time after Jan. 2, 2020,” Accordino added.

About Hull

Hull has previously served as CFO at both public and private companies with domestic and international operations in a career spanning more than three and a half decades.

Hull most recently was senior advisor on corporate strategy and capital markets projects at Realogy Holdings Corp. and previously was the company’s executive VP CFO, and treasurer from 2006 to 2018.

Hull also previously served as executive VP, finance at Cendant Corporation in the New York City area from 2003 to 2005.

Earlier in his career, Hull was head of finance, accounting and information technology at DreamWorks, LLC from 1996 to 2003; CFO at King World Productions, Inc. from 1994 to 1995; and corporate VP, financial planning at Paramount Communications, Inc. from 1990 to 1994.

He began his career at Morgan Stanley & Co. in the mergers and acquisitions department for the media/entertainment group, where he served as associate and later VP from 1984 to 1990.

Hull currently sits on the board of directors for New York City–based Landis Technologies, a startup venture that provides assistance and guidance to families in attaining home ownership on an accelerated basis.
